Remember to maintain security and privacy. Do not share sensitive information. Procedimento.com.br may make mistakes. Verify important information. Termo de Responsabilidade
Público-Alvo: Iniciantes e entusiastas do Arduino que desejam aprender sobre o uso e aplicação de resistores em projetos eletrônicos.
Os resistores são componentes fundamentais em projetos eletrônicos, incluindo aqueles desenvolvidos com Arduino. Eles desempenham um papel essencial na limitação de corrente, divisão de tensão, ajuste de níveis de sinal e muitas outras aplicações. Neste artigo, vamos explorar em detalhes o uso de resistores no Arduino, fornecendo exemplos práticos e códigos para auxiliar no aprendizado.
Projeto: O projeto que será criado como exemplo é um circuito simples de controle de intensidade de luz usando um LED e um potenciômetro. O objetivo é permitir que o usuário ajuste a intensidade do LED girando o potenciômetro.
Lista de componentes:
Exemplos:
Exemplo de uso de resistor para limitar a corrente do LED:
int ledPin = 9;
int resistorValue = 220;
void setup() {
pinMode(ledPin, OUTPUT);
}
void loop() {
analogWrite(ledPin, 255); // Define o brilho máximo do LED
delay(1000);
analogWrite(ledPin, 0); // Desliga o LED
delay(1000);
}
Exemplo de uso de resistor para divisão de tensão:
int analogPin = A0;
int resistorValue = 10000;
void setup() {
Serial.begin(9600);
}
void loop() {
int sensorValue = analogRead(analogPin);
float voltage = sensorValue * (5.0 / 1023.0); // Converte o valor lido para tensão
float resistance = (resistorValue * voltage) / (5.0 - voltage); // Calcula a resistência
Serial.print("Tensão: ");
Serial.print(voltage);
Serial.print("V, Resistência: ");
Serial.print(resistance);
Serial.println(" ohms");
delay(1000);
}
Compartilhe este artigo com seus amigos que também estão interessados no Arduino e desejam aprender mais sobre o uso de resistores em projetos eletrônicos. Juntos, podemos expandir nosso conhecimento e criar projetos incríveis!